Before reviewing changes to the solver, please read the constraint-weighting rationale, since several coefficients look arbitrary but encode hard-won field lessons from the Bexley pilot fleet. The simulation harness in `sim/` replays two weeks of real demand traces, and any solver change must keep manifest cost within 2% of baseline. The weighting rationale, trace format, and acceptance thresholds are all documented on this internal page.

dashboard of bafof-hafog = https://confluence.lumiclabs.internal/display/browse/display/6a09a20a

Handover — Merrow House goods lift. Lift B is reserved for deliveries 07:00–11:00 daily; contractors must not use passenger lifts for pallets. Book slots via the loading bay sheet. Keys stay with the dock supervisor. For after-hours access the lift panel needs the following pass code.

door code, yagap-bahof: bdg-O-05

Fleet fuel-usage report (Cartwheel Logistics). Runs nightly at 02:00 against the telemetry warehouse. If the report is missing by 06:00, check the ingest job first — odometer batches from the Harlox depot often arrive late. Rerun with the --window flag set to the prior day only; full backfills need sign-off. Do not ship the release notes until the report lands. When paging the on-call, include the build token shown below.

pipeline stamp: htk4_ae36